Comment on "Disentangling the drivers of β diversity along latitudinal and elevational gradients".

Tuomisto H, Ruokolainen K.

Source

Department of Biology, University of Turku, Turku, Finland. hanna.tuomisto@utu.fi

Abstract

Kraft et al. (Report, 23 September 2011, p. 1755) argued that the latitudinal trend in β diversity is spurious and just reflects a trend in γ diversity. Their results depend on the idiosyncrasies of their data, especially the latitudinally varying degree of undersampling and a local sampling setup that is not suitable for analyzing drivers of β diversity.

Comment on "Disentangling the drivers of β diversity along latitudinal and elevational gradients".

Qian H, Wang X, Zhang Y.

Source

Research and Collections Center, Illinois State Museum, Springfield, IL 62703, USA. hqian@museum.state.il.us

Abstract

Kraft et al. (Report, 23 September 2011, p. 1755) analyzed two data sets and concluded that "there is no need to invoke differences in the mechanisms of community assembly in temperate versus tropical systems to explain these global-scale patterns of β diversity." We show that their conclusion is based on inappropriate data and inadequate methods of analysis.
